Kenya: Okundi endorsed in Kisumu

By Dickens Wasonga.

The race to clinch Homa Bay county governor’s seat is hotting up. On Monday prominent politician and immediate former Member of Parliament for Rangwe engineer Philip Okundi also eying the seat got a boost for his bid when he was endorsed by eight civic leaders from the area.

The civic leaders made the endorsement after a daylong meeting convened and attended by the wealthy and influential politician at an exclusive upmarket resort in Kisumu City.

Led by the Homa Bay municipal council Mayor Councillor Charles Katinga the leaders said they have opted to throw their weight behind Okundi given his past development record over the years in the area.

He said that Okundi is the only candidate who has come out to openly seek for their support for his bid for the governor’s position in the forth coming general elections

Okundi worked in public service for a long time holding key government positions amongst them as the managing director of the Kenya Bureau of standards. He was also the MD Kenya Ports Authority at one point among other positions.

Before he resigned from the government recently to contest the governor seat, he was the chairman of the Communications commission of Kenya.

Okundi lost his Rangwe seat at the last general elections to a relative newcomer in politics Martin Ogindo who is the current sitting Mp.
